WebThe Cave of Swimmers is a cave with ancient rock art in the mountainous Gilf Kebir plateau of the Libyan Desert section of the Sahara. It is located in the New Valley Governorate of southwest Egypt, near the border with Libya. WebThe first depictions of breaststroke can be found as cave paintings in southwestern Egypt: The “Cave of the Swimmers” was discovered in 1933 on the Gilf-el-Kebir Plateau and contains numerous drawings of people swimming breaststroke. These paintings are believed to have been made about 10,000 to 5,500 years ago, when Africa was still ... Web10,000-year-old rock paintings of people swimming were found in the Cave of Swimmers near Wadi Sura in southwestern Egypt.These pictures seem to show breaststroke or doggy paddle, although it is also possible that the movements have a ritual meaning unrelated to swimming.An Egyptian clay seal dated between 9000 BC and 4000 BC shows four …

The Cave of Swimmers is an ancient rock art cave located in the New Valley Governorate of southwest Egypt. It contains Neolithic pictographs and is named due to the depictions of people with their limbs bent as if they were swimming.
